Reception Newsletter
This week our classroom was over taken by pirates! We have had lots of fun with some pirate themed learning. The children completed some super pirate writing as well as lots of adventure talk, creating and following maps to find treasure. We had a focus on junk modelling. As well as learning new ways to join materials together, children were encouraged to plan and evaluate their work, thinking about how we can improve our work by adding extra detail and decoration.
In R.E. we talked about how Christians believe that God created our beautiful world and that God trusts humans to take care of it. We wondered about how incredible it is that so many different animals and plants exist and we finished our ‘Earth from space’ pictures – the glitter came out!
It was another hot one, so lots of water play to stay cool and the water mister came out again. (We are enjoyng spraying the children way too much!) The playground was too hot and sunny for running games, so we did some ‘under the sea’ yoga in the classroom instead!
We have begun to talk about the transition to year 1 and have started a countdown on our classroom calander to the school holidays. As we go into next week we will be taking part in transition activities as well as free flow play between our classroom and the year 1 classroom. I hope that the the children will become excited about the prospect of moving on and up, as they begin to understand how they have grown way too big and clever now for reception!
